{"data":{"id":"us-wv/w.-va.-code-46-9-622","jurisdiction":"us-wv","citation":"W. Va. Code § 46-9-622","heading":"Effect of acceptance of collateral.","body":"(a) Effect of acceptance. A secured party's acceptance of collateral in full or partial satisfaction of the obligation it secures:\n(1) Discharges the obligation to the extent consented to by the debtor;\n(2) Transfers to the secured party all of a debtor's rights in the collateral;\n(3) Discharges the security interest or agricultural lien that is the subject of the debtor's consent and any subordinate security interest or other subordinate lien; and\n(4) Terminates any other subordinate interest.\n(b) Discharge of subordinate interest notwithstanding noncompliance. A subordinate interest is discharged or terminated under subsection (a) of this section, even if the secured party fails to comply with this article.","path":["CHAPTER 46.
